Custom Training Specialist (PA)

Finger Lakes Community College
Canandaigua, NY

Job Description

Job Description

The Custom Training Specialist is responsible for assisting the Director of Workforce, Career and Experiential Learning and professional staff by providing planning, coordination, supervision, and organization of non-credit, continuing education programming to meet the specific criteria for businesses, employers, and industry
trends. Responsible for set up and physical delivery of training programs.

Qualifications :

Educational Background: Associate’s degree required; Bachelor’s degree preferred.

Experience: A minimum of three years’ training management experience is required. Workforce development and/or training experience is preferred. Experience working with the public, including businesses and state agencies that deal with workforce needs and funding, is also preferred.

Skills: Proficient in various computer programs, including MS Office Suite. Ability to create marketing materials, identify target audiences, and promote courses preferred. Ability to work independently and with minimal direction. Excellent decision-making and organizational skills. Excellent interpersonal and communication skills (written and oral). Detail-oriented with excellent follow-through skills. Knowledge of, respect for, and successful engagement with members of other cultures or backgrounds. Commitment to training, education, and accountability in efforts to promote a culture of inclusion and belonging.

Essential Functions:

  1. Training project management to include hire and supervision of trainers, course development including planning, scheduling and course evaluations.

  2. Oversight of custom training programs to include the following industries: computer, leadership, healthcare and human services, manufacturing, service-related fields, and other non-credit training programs as required by the business community.

  3. Develop and maintain existing NY State and College reports that show results related to program outcomes.

  4. Develop a methodology to monitor and adapt to changing market conditions aimed at
    furthering the College’s success in workforce development.

  5. Coordinate with other potential partners, internal and external, who can assist with delivery of
    community workforce development and community education needs to assure efficient use of
    resources.

  6. Development of specialized custom training programs as requested by business/industry
    opportunities.

  7. Provide and implement promotion, advertising and course publication, participant
    registrations, and all post-course responsibilities, including evaluations/tracking, statistical
    follow-ups and state reports.

  8. Responsible for developing and administrating training contracts with business, industry and other employers, as well as workshops and conferences that meet specific professional
    development needs within the private and public sectors of the community.

  9. Develop budget for training programs provided, including hiring trainers and purchasing
    supplies and educational materials.

  10. Develop and maintain non-credit personal and professional development courses on campus
    and at off-campus locations.

  11. Work, where appropriate, with academic department chairs and faculty to develop non-credit
    programs and courses with identified needs and interests in the community.

  12. Conduct training when/where appropriate to businesses, counties and governmental agencies.

  13. Work with local Workforce Development offices to qualify participants for online and non-credit vocational training.

Benefits and salary range:

Applicants receiving benefits through the New York State Retirement System should review state regulations regarding post-retirement employment. This position is not eligible for employment under a Section 211 waiver

  1. Competitive starting salary in the range of $48,847 to $51,289 and is commensurate with qualifications

  2. A flexible work schedule is available upon successful completion of training. This position follows a hybrid model, with a combination of on-site and remote work.

  3. NYS retirement or Optional SUNY Retirement Program

  4. SUNY Voluntary Savings Plan

  5. Comprehensive Health and Dental Insurance through Excellus BCBS

  6. FSA

  7. 21 days of annual leave, 12 sick days, and 13.5 holidays annually

  8. FLCC Tuition Waiver for employee and dependents

  9. Tuition assistance – 4-year institutions
